Getting Started
Turning On
Press and hold the power switch (
è
page 4) until the power indicator
(
è
page 4) lights.
NOTE
l
Do not press the power switch repeatedly.
l
The computer will forcibly be turned off if you press and hold the power switch for four seconds or longer.
l
Once you turn off the computer, wait for ten seconds or more before you turn on the computer again.
l
Do not perform the following operation until the drive indicator turns off.
• Connecting or disconnecting the AC adaptor
• Pressing the power switch
• Touching the tablet buttons, screen or external mouse
• Turn on/off the wireless switch

Precaution against Starting Up/Shutting Down
l
Do not do the following
• Connecting or disconnecting the AC adaptor
• Pressing the power switch
• Touching the tablet buttons, screen or external mouse
• Turn on/off the wireless switch
NOTE
l
To conserve power, the following power saving methods are set at the time of purchase.
• The screen automatically turns off after :
10 minutes (when AC adaptor is connected) of inactivity
5 minutes (when operating on battery power) of inactivity
• The computer automatically enters sleep*1 after :
20 minutes (when AC adaptor is connected) of inactivity
15 minutes (when operating on battery power) of inactivity
*1
Refer to Reference Manual “Sleep or Hibernation Functions” about resuming from sleep.
